What are the typical fees for a personal injury lawyer in Atlanta?

In Atlanta, personal injury lawyers commonly work on a contingency fee basis, where their fee is a percentage of the settlement or award, typically between 30% and 40%. This fee is only collected if the case is won. Costs associated with the case, such as filing fees and expert witness expenses, may also be discussed. What information do I need for a car accident attorney consultation?

For a car accident attorney consultation in Longmont, bring any documentation you have: the police report, photos of the scene and vehicles, witness contact information, and medical records related to your injuries. Be prepared to describe the accident and its aftermath in detail. This allows the attorney to assess your case thoroughly. We can arrange a free quote to start this process.
